How much do junior microsoft access database developer j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 25, 2026, the average yearly pay for junior microsoft access database developer in the United States is $66,690.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$50,000.00 and $75,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Junior Microsoft Access Database Developer vs Data Analyst?

AspectJunior Microsoft Access Database DeveloperData Analyst
Required SkillsAccess database design, VBA, SQL, basic data managementData analysis, SQL, Excel, visualization tools
Work EnvironmentOffice settings, small to medium businesses, IT teamsBusiness units, finance, marketing, IT departments
CertificationsMicrosoft Office Specialist, Access certificationsMicrosoft Certified Data Analyst, Excel certifications

Junior Microsoft Access Database Developers focus on creating and maintaining Access databases, often within small to medium businesses, using VBA and SQL. Data Analysts analyze data sets, generate reports, and use visualization tools. While both roles require SQL knowledge and some certifications, their primary responsibilities and tools differ, with developers concentrating on database development and analysts on data interpretation.

Position Overview

Chartis Federal is seeking a Senior MS Access Database Developer to serve as the technical lead supporting the USDA Budget Object Breakdown (BOB) Financial Management Tool. This position will provide development, maintenance, modernization, and operational support for financial management applications and related databases.


Duties and Responsibilities

  • Serve as the lead developer for the BOB Financial Management Tool
  • Design, develop, maintain, and enhance Microsoft Access applications and databases
  • Support MariaDB database integration and data management activities
  • Develop reports, dashboards, interfaces and automated processes
  • Troubleshoot application issues and perform root cause analysis
  • Support system modernization and migration initiatives
  • Coordinate with financial analysts, business users, and technical stakeholders
  • Develop technical documentation, user guides, and system procedures
  • Ensure compliance with USDA security and development standards
Requirements:
  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, or related field
  • Minimum of 8 years of experience developing and supporting Microsoft Access applications
  • Experience with SQL, MariaDB, VBA, and database administration
  • Experience integrating cloud-hosted applications and databases
  • Strong troubleshooting, analytical, and communication skills
  • Experience supporting federal financial systems preferred
